    Mstty said:
    michaels said:
    Switched everything on remotely but forgot to turn off the V2H so the first 30 mins of the adjustment period was a bit of a write off.  Now have both cars charging, dishwasher and washing machine running and house heated by electric rads rather than gas.  Should really put the immersion tank on boost too but that involves a trip to the loft so CBA.  May see if our oven has a burn off cleaning programme.
    I do wonder if anyone has tripped their fuse board yet with the amount of amp load. 
    I accidentally hit around 114A. I didn’t realise at the time but our grid voltage had dropped to 212v. We are supplied from a transformer on a pole 3 houses away and varies a lot. When our PV is flat out we can see grid voltages as high as 259V. 
    Edit: It wasn’t intentional. I had been keeping to around 18kw with a max of 21kw but unexpectedly the immersion heater kicked in and it went up to 24.3 kW. With a typical voltage in the mid 240s I thought this was a bit too close to the 100A of the fuse so immediately brought it back down to 21kW. It was only later that I looked at the voltage log.
